Cook's Fin represents the westernmost part of Cooks Wall. It received its name because looking at it from a distance, it gives the appearance of a rocky dorsal fin silhouetted along the back sloping west end of Cooks Wall. The routes are good and it's one of the largest concentrations of climbs at Cooks but the rock quality does suffer some being that the cliff breakdown begins here.
